Find the sum of the measures of the interior angles of apolygon with 10 sides.​

Mathematics
1 answer:
motikmotik3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

1440

Step-by-step explanation:

The sum of the exterior angles of a regular polygon of 10 sides = 360 deg. The sum of the interior angles of a regular polygon of 10 sides = 10*[180 - (360/10)] = 10(180–36) = 10*144 = 1440 deg.

Simon must maintain an average grade of 80% or better in his math class to be eligible to play sports.His math grade so far are
Sophie [7]

Answer:

Let x be the percentage score he got in fifth test,

According to the question,

His score in first, second, third and fourth test are 80%, 84%, 76% and 77% respectively,

Thus, the average of his total score in the five test,

= \frac{80+84+76+77+x}{5}

But, Again according to the question,

The average of the five grades as greater than or equal to 80%

That is,

\frac{80+84+76+77+x}{5}\geq 80

⇒ \frac{317+x}{5}\geq 80

⇒ 317 + x \geq 400

⇒ x\geq 83

Thus, the least score he can get in the fifth test is 83.

What is the slope of the line that goes through the points (-3, 8) and (0, 23)?
Kipish [7]

Answer:

5

Step-by-step explanation:

(-3, 8) and (0, 23)

m=(y2-y1)/(x2-x1)

m=(23 - 8)/(0+3)

m=(15)/3

m = 5

Is 5 1/2 rational or irrational ?
-Dominant- [34]

Answer:

Rational

Step-by-step explanation:

It is a rational number because any number that can be rewritten as a simple fraction is a rational number. This means that natural/counting numbers, whole numbers and integers, like 5, are all part of the set of rational numbers as well because they can be written as fractions, as are mixed numbers such as 1 ½.
